John Lapunka

John Lapunka, 90, of Fort Wayne, IN, and having ties to Roanoke, IN, died Saturday, Aug. 10, 2013.

Mr. Lapunka was founder and CEO of Financial Advisory Clinic and worked for Equitable Life Assurance Co. He was a member of St. Joseph Catholic Church, Roanoke, and had been a member of the Anthony Wayne Rotary Club for more than 50 years. He was a World War II Army veteran.

He was born Dec. 13, 1922, in Cleveland, OH, to Wasyl and Mary Lapunka. He was preceded in death by his wife, Ann Lapunka, in 1983.

Survivors include three daughters, Mary (Joe) Sutton, Martha (David) Guthrie and Caitie (Jerry) Linger; a sister, Ann Bair; seven grandchildren, Chris (Jason) Howey, Brooke (Joe) Stanley, Anna Kirsten (Matt) Owens, Becka (Tarik) Pellerin, Nina Linger, Noah Linger and Kit Linger; and three great-grandchildren.
